Pizza? When I lived in Seattle I thought the best pizza in the state was at the North Lake Tavern near lake Union. But now that I live in the Couv the best in the state is Juliano's on Mill Plain about 156 ave which would be on your way from BGround to the airport area. It has reopened now. It was closed for several months due to a kitchen fire and I'm super glad it's back open now.
 
When in Portland, Kann is an excellent date-night option. https://kannrestaurant.com/

Reservations required though they do have a bar that might support walk-ins.

Firehouse as mentioned by @clarkman used to be another good choice though I haven’t been there in years. I think my brother’s friend is still the chef/owner. (Edit: just learned my brother’s friend sold it some years back so now = ?)
